这里是文章模块栏目内容页
mysql时间相等(mysql 时间间隔)

导读:时间相等是MySQL中非常重要的一个概念,它可以帮助我们在数据库中进行更加精确的数据查询和操作。本文将从多个方面介绍MySQL中时间相等的相关知识点,包括日期格式、时间戳、时间函数等。

1. 日期格式

在MySQL中,日期和时间可以使用不同的格式进行存储和表示。其中,最常见的日期格式是YYYY-MM-DD,例如2022-01-01。这种格式可以通过DATE类型进行存储和比较,例如:

SELECT * FROM table WHERE date_column = '2022-01-01';

如果需要比较具体的时间,可以使用DATETIME类型,例如:

SELECT * FROM table WHERE datetime_column = '2022-01-01 12:00:00';

2. 时间戳

时间戳是一种表示时间的数字格式,它表示自1970年1月1日以来经过的秒数。在MySQL中,可以使用UNIX_TIMESTAMP()函数将日期转换为时间戳,例如:

SELECT UNIX_TIMESTAMP('2022-01-01 12:00:00');

输出结果为1641043200,即2022年1月1日12点的时间戳。在比较时间时,可以直接比较时间戳大小,例如:

SELECT * FROM table WHERE timestamp_column = 1641043200;

3. 时间函数

MySQL提供了许多用于处理时间的函数,例如NOW()函数可以获取当前时间,例如:

SELECT NOW();

输出结果为当前时间,例如2022-01-01 12:00:00。另外,DATE_ADD()和DATE_SUB()函数可以进行时间加减操作,例如:

SELECT DATE_ADD('2022-01-01', INTERVAL 1 DAY);

输出结果为2022-01-02,即在2022年1月1日的基础上加1天。

总结:时间相等是MySQL中非常重要的一个概念,本文从日期格式、时间戳、时间函数等多个方面介绍了MySQL中时间相等的相关知识点。掌握这些知识可以帮助我们更加精确地查询和操作数据库中的数据。